What happens if the alimony debtor in Mexico does not comply with alimony due to a natural disaster that seriously affects their property and finances?

If the alimony debtor in Mexico cannot comply with alimony due to a natural disaster that seriously affects their property and finances, they must notify the court about their situation. The court will consider these circumstances and may temporarily adjust the amount of the alimony or establish a payment plan appropriate to the debtor's new financial situation. It is important to provide evidence of the natural disaster and its impact on finances. Judicial authorities are often understanding in such situations, but it is essential to follow legal procedures to ensure a fair review.

What should I do if my Personal Identification Document (DPI) has expired and I need to renew it?

If your DPI has expired, you must go to RENAP and request the renewal of the document. You must present the established requirements for renewal, including the expired DPI, recent photograph and pay the corresponding fee.

What are the requirements to request the international return of a minor in Peru?

To request the international return of a minor in Peru, certain requirements must be met, such as that the minor has been transferred illicitly or without the consent of the other parent, that there is a judicial resolution or legal agreement in force on custody or visits , and that Peru is the country of habitual residence of the minor.

How is the process of applying for a disability pension in the DR?

The application for a disability pension in the Dominican Republic is made through the Social Security Treasury (TSS). You must submit an application along with medical evidence demonstrating your disability and inability to work. The TSS will evaluate your case and, if you meet the requirements, will grant you a disability pension.
